Content calculation
With polarographic and voltammetric methods, the measured
evaluation quantities (
Height
,
Area
or
Derivative
) for a substance
are proportional to its mass concentration. The relation between
evaluation quantity and mass concentration must be determined
by a calibration with reference solutions. The 757 VA Computrace
offers the following two techniques for this:
Standard addition
Content determination using single or multiple addition of a
standard solution.
Calibration curve
Content determination using a calibration curve previously de-
termined with reference solutions.
The goal of these calibration methods is to calculate the sample
mass concentration c(s) which is defined by the found substance
mass
Mass
and the sample amount in the measuring vessel
Sam-
ple
amount
:
c(s) =
Mass / Sample amount
